Meghan Markle is opening up about the everyday challenges of modern life in a newly released episode of her podcast series, “Confessions of a Female Founder”, following Princess Kate Middleton’s powerful message on the healing connection between people and nature.
The Duchess of Sussex featured Heather Hasson, co-founder of the medical apparel brand FIGS, as her guest in the latest episode. Together, the two women dove into the realities of building a business from the ground up, touching on the highs, lows, and lessons learned through entrepreneurship.

They also explored the importance of staying connected to the small, daily details that often go unnoticed but make a big difference in both business and personal life.
During the episode, Meghan shared a rare personal anecdote about her own struggles in the kitchen. After Heather admitted to not being the best cook, Meghan responded with a relatable take:
“I think the whole point for me is when you see something that’s an easy solve in the everyday, that’s not complicated, not fussy, how do you get your hands involved and change the way of thinking surrounding it so it doesn’t feel daunting?”
The Duchess also reflected on balancing motherhood and meals for Prince Archie and Princess Lilibet:
“I see vegetables, and I see takeout — because I don’t have time to cook every day — and I go, how do I still make this flattering, beautiful and present well and something people find appetising?”
